RETURN OF BALANGIGA BELLS SHOWS DUTERTE’S COMMITMENT TO DELIVER PROMISES – GO

The return of the famed Balangiga bells proves President Rodrigo Duterte’s commitment to deliver his promises to the people, former Special Assistant to the President (SAP) Bong Go said.

“Isa po ito sa kanyang pinanawagan noong last State of the Nation Address last July na darating na talaga, nang pinabalik ito ni Pangulong Duterte. What is due to us so ibabalik po ito sa Samar at mismong si Pangulong (Rodrigo) Duterte ang magbabalik nito sa Sabado,” Go said in an ambush interview when he visited fire victims in Tondo recently.

The former presidential aide said it was through the sheer political will of President Duterte that the country managed to successfully reclaim the bells of Balangiga from the Americans.

Several attempts in the past to reclaim the bells have failed.

However, the former Palace official said the President is not interested in who would get credit for bringing the bells back.

“Duterte is not interested in who would get credit for bringing the bells back.”

“Si Pangulong Duterte naman po ay never nakipag-agawan ng credit ‘yan kung sino ang nag trabaho nito, tignan n’yo po ‘yung mga proyekto n’ya walang nakalagay na pangalan n’ya dahil para sa kanya trabaho lang s’ya,” Go said.

“So ito namang nangyari sa Balangiga bells ang pagbabalik po nito ay effort po ni Pangulong Duterte pero ayaw n’ya po kunin ang credit nito, ang importante po ay naibalik sa Pilipinas at naibalik sa Pilipino,” he added.

Go bared that he will accompany the President to Samar as the Chief Executive will personally see the delivery of the bells back to their rightful place after 117 years and turn them over to local officials.

“Nag-usap na po kami kagabi, we decided to go to Samar to bring the bells,” he said.

The Balangiga bells gained fame after being taken by American soldiers in 1901 as war trophies during the Philippine-American war.
